How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Austin?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Austin Studio Apartments with Rent Specials | $1,282 | $627 | $5,053 |
| Austin 1 Bedroom Apartments with Rent Specials | $1,467 | $500 | $10,000+ |
| Austin 2 Bedroom Apartments with Rent Specials | $1,854 | $624 | $10,000+ |
| Austin 3 Bedroom Apartments with Rent Specials | $2,177 | $685 | $10,000+ |
| Austin 4 Bedroom Apartments with Rent Specials | $2,024 | $575 | $10,000+ |
| Austin 5 Bedroom Apartments | $2,943 | $830 | $7,314 |
| Austin 6 Bedroom Apartments | $2,107 | $814 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Rent Specials Austin Apartments
What is the Cheapest Rent Specials apartment in Austin?
Currently the most affordable Rent Specials Apartment in Austin is at Town Lake listed at $575.
How much is the average rent for a Rent Specials Austin Apartment?
The average rent for a Rent Specials Apartment in Austin is $1,955.
What is the largest Rent Specials Austin Apartment for rent?
Today's Rent Specials apartment with the most square footage in Austin is a 3,218 square feet unit starting from $3,318 at Ashton Austin.
What is the average size for Austin Rent Specials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Rent Specials rental in Austin is currently at 605 sq ft.
